Does Coral Rehabilitation and Nursing of Arlington have a federal violation or abuse history?

According to the public federal record on file with the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S), Coral Rehabilitation and Nursing of Arlington (CCN 675112) has federal inspection findings on its record. CMS currently displays its federal abuse icon for this facility — a flag CMS assigns under its own published methodology for abuse-related citations (deficiency tag F600 and related). CMS also lists the facility in its Special Focus Facility program, the federal watch list CMS reserves for nursing homes with a persistent record of serious deficiencies. In its current inspection cycle, CMS cited the facility for 26 deficiencies; the most serious carries scope/severity K, a level CMS classifies as Immediate Jeopardy. Citations from earlier inspection cycles appear in the dated timeline below as historical findings, not current ones. CMS has $312,466 in civil money penalties on file against the facility.
